Why remote location emergency treatment is different

In community, emergency treatment is usually a sprint. You handle the air passage, begin CPR, apply a defib, or control blood loss, after that turn over to paramedics within minutes. In remote contexts, it ends up being a marathon. You make the exact same preliminary moves, after that clear up in for surveillance, issue resolving, and safe discharge over an unpredictable timeframe. Warmth, surface, wild animals, weather, car access, and navigation all form what is actually possible.

North Lakes homeowners are bordered by environments that make time stretch. A rolled ankle at Mount Ngungun's base ends up being a multi-hour bring if the person can not walk. A deep hand laceration while fishing the tidewater might not hemorrhage out, yet it requires strong pressure, clever dressing, and calm transport across sand and tide. Snakebite period adds another layer. Understanding the difference in between panic and seriousness, and using the best technique, sits at the heart of remote care.

Skills that matter when aid is far

Good remote training constructs around core proficiencies, after that layers in context. The fundamentals never ever change: preserve life, protect against degeneration, and advertise healing. The means you deliver them does.

Airway, breathing, flow, special needs, direct exposure remains the foundation. In remote settings, you include a 6th letter: environment. You will certainly attend to heat, cold, rainfall, and surface early, because a shivering or overheating individual deteriorates faster.

CPR training North Lakes remains essential, with focus on top quality compressions and secure defibrillator usage. In remote treatment, you also discover when prolonged CPR might be useless and exactly how to securely manage the scene if you must proceed for longer than typical. A mouth-to-mouth resuscitation correspondence course North Lakes every year keeps these electric motor abilities sharp; compression deepness and hand positioning fade if you never practice.

Bleeding control handles additional nuance. Tourniquets and pressure dressings are more probable to feature when extraction is sluggish. Excellent courses show improvisated approaches making use of triangular plasters, apparel, or cravats. I have brought a patient over uneven ground with a makeshift splint and a stress cover that stood up for two hours, because it was applied properly the very first time, and examined every fifteen mins for circulation.

Fractures and strains are common bush injuries. You will certainly learn to align, splint, and support, yet also to decide when to quit movement completely. In high country, moving a client with a thought back injury is a case-by-case choice. A course worth its salt will certainly imitate this decision making as opposed to reciting guidelines from a slide.

Environmental threats are various around North Lakes than in towering areas. Warmth tension, dehydration, aquatic stings, and snakebite sit higher on the checklist. A reputable first aid course North Lakes, particularly one tuned to remote or outside circumstances, must drill you on stress immobilisation for envenomation. The specifics issue: wide stretchable bandage, strong stress from fingers to groin or toes to hip, no clean, no cut, no suction, and immobilisation of the entire limb. It appears simple, yet I have seen people tighten as well hard, or neglect to immobilise joints, or unwrap to "examine" the bite, every one of which harm outcomes.

Prolonged individual care includes tasks you will not see simply put urban events. Monitoring a patient's mental state, skin temperature, and pulse quality over hours. Little sips for hydration when suitable, not downing water that causes throwing up. Managing pain with safe positioning, not just tablets you may not have. Making use of sanctuary wisely to control direct exposure. Communicating updates to rescuers while preserving battery life, which is an ability in itself.

Gear that functions when distance grows

You can not lug a facility on your back, however you can bring a kit that punches above its weight. For North Lakes and borders, packages should be modular. Maintain a daily bag in your car and day pack, after that a bigger roll for team journeys or work sites. In remote emergency treatment training in North Lakes, I urge people to develop sets around situations, not brands. You want products that carry out in sweat, sand, and rain.

What belongs in the core kit? A well-stocked pressure plaster set that includes a minimum of two broad elastic bandages for snakebite and extreme bleeds. A portable North Lakes first aid injury dressing that can function as a stress pad. Triangular plasters that do triple task as slings, swathes, or improvisated tourniquets. A splint that can be formed and secured with tape. Tweezers and a small saline vial for grit, yet no fiddling with injuries you can not cleanse. Electrolyte salts for warmth stress. A lightweight emergency blanket that withstands tearing. Nitrile gloves in a size that in fact fits your hands. A marker for timing plasters, specifically in envenomation or tourniquet usage. Ultimately, redundancy for light and communication.

Training issues more than brand names. I have actually seen pricey kits fail since the proprietor didn't know just how to use the contents under tension. A sensible consider mouth-to-mouth resuscitation in remote settings

CPR is simple in principle and brutal in method. On a gym floor with music and a metronome, you can maintain compressions for two minutes without breaking a sweat. On a sandy foredune with the trend inbound and no color, you will discover just how fast your rate decreases and deepness comes to be irregular. This is where quality training matters.

When you take cpr courses North Lakes, ask whether the course prepares you for endurance management. Great trainers turn compressors every 2 mins, educate you to lock arm joints and use body weight, and tension early callouts for aid. In remote areas, if you are alone, you will certainly also require to determine whether to bring assistance initially or start compressions. The correct choice depends on the patient's problem and exactly how rapid aid can reasonably show up, an uncomfortable grey location that deserves straightforward conversation during training.

AED accessibility can be sporadic outdoors community centers. Emergency treatment and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ation training courses North Lakes must still teach AED make use of thoroughly, with the pointer that a defib's triggers do not change scientific judgment. You must still inspect air passage, eliminate excess dampness, and cut hefty breast hair if required to make certain pad call. Exercising these little tasks on a dummy in tidy clothes is one point. Doing them on a sweaty, sand-covered breast is one more. Ask to experiment challenges simulated.

Snakebite season and pressure immobilisation

Spring via late summer is when most regional snake encounters take place. The book recommendations is extensively recognized, yet implementation fails in the minute. I have seen 3 typical mistakes: moving the patient prematurely, uneven bandage tension, and failure to immobilise the limb fully.

In a solid North Lakes first aid training session, you need to bandage a limb correctly under time pressure. Beginning at the bite site if known, or the fingers or toes if unknown, after that cover with company, even pressure up the limb, covering all skin. Examine capillary refill in extremities to avoid cutting off blood circulation, after that immobilise with a splint and sling or a leg wrap to the opposite arm or leg. Mark the time and do not eliminate the bandage till healthcare facility treatment. No cutting, no sucking, no cleaning. Driving a client who can lie still may serve if rescue access is postponed, yet the best course is to call for aid and minimise activity. A remote module will emphasise positioning, communication with dispatch concerning access points, and constant confidence to minimize the patient's heart rate.

Managing warm and hydration north of Brisbane

The mix of humidity and sunlight drives dehydration quicker than individuals anticipate. Also on a windy day around the Glass Residence Mountains, you can sweat via your water faster than intended. Early indicators include a persistent migraine, impatience, and dark urine. Left uncontrolled, warmth exhaustion can proceed to heat stroke, a life-threatening emergency.

First aid and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ation North Lakes programs that deal with remote care ought to show functional hydration plans: sip timetables as opposed to huge gulps, electrolyte balance instead of ordinary water in huge volumes, and remainder cycles in color. Identifying when to stop a stroll is among one of the most important skills. I once transformed a group around just one kilometre from the search since two participants were revealing heat tension indications we can manage now yet not later. No one thanked me at the time. Everyone thanked me at the auto park.

For work staffs, integrate warmth management right into the task strategy. If you are accountable for a site, ensure cool water and electrolytes get on hand and that the very first aider can intensify promptly without preconception. Remote training typically includes preparation for working alone or in little groups, with set up radio checks that function as well-being checks.

Communication, navigation, and the shed hour

A well-executed first aid feedback can be undone by poor navigating or communication. Inconsistent mobile insurance coverage around the hinterland implies you need a layered plan. Prior to you go out, tell somebody your path and return time. On site, recognize access points for emergency situation cars and the local named road or gate number. Usage collaborates if you have them, however be ready to define landmarks.

Some North Lakes first aid training courses now consist of basic navigation jobs in their remote modules, which is ideal. Even a short practice on utilizing a phone app's offline maps or an easy grid referral can reduce action times. A spare power financial institution is not a luxury. It maintains your phone to life for updates with send off and allows you save the major battery by switching off unnecessary services.

Refreshers and skill retention

Skills weaken faster than certificates expire. CPR method starts to slip within months if you do not practice. Wrapping and splinting, which require mastery, take advantage of refresher courses also if your documents remains legitimate for longer. A cpr refresher course North Lakes yearly is a reasonable standard, specifically for anyone most likely to be a first -responder at work or in outdoor groups.

For remote abilities, informal method works wonders. Take ten minutes before a hike to practice a pressure immobilisation cover on a buddy's leg, after that examine capillary refill. Run a radio examine a channel you intend to use. Testimonial your extraction plan with your team leader and recognize back-ups in situation a bridge is closed or a track erodes.

When training satisfies reality: 2 neighborhood scenarios

A summer season mid-day on the Pine River, a fish back punctures a hand during landing. The individual vows and tries to rinse in salty water. Discomfort spikes, and bleeding is moderate. A qualified initial aider stops the rinse, makes use of tidy water and a gauze to carefully flush exterior debris only, after that applies a firm pressure dressing and boosts the hand. They examine tetanus status, think about the threat of marine bacteria, and suggest prompt clinical evaluation instead of waiting until night. The difference is a night in immediate care as opposed to an unpleasant infection that blooms by morning.

image

On a fire trail west of Beerburrum, a hiker steps awkwardly and listens to the classic pop of a serious ankle sprain. No defect suggests fracture, yet weight bearing is difficult. The group's trained member cools the joint briefly, after that uses a wide compression wrap in a figure-eight with a rigid support on each side utilizing a foam splint. They determine not to bush-bash a faster way that takes the chance of further injury. Rather, they mark their setting, call for assistance with clear directions to the local entrance, and move the client gradually in a sustained seat lug only regarding needed to a shaded, level area for pick-up. It is not heroics. It is excellent judgment.
